Any good joiner or carpenter should have access to a quality sander that should be able to remove the majority of the stain in question. However, because a stain penetrates into the grain of the timber far more than a varnish or paint, some of the staining may remain in a limited fashion. The results will depend entirely on the timber of the door itself and its porosity, the stain used and the number of coats applied.

Softwoods are very porous and will hold the stain deeper than hardwoods but a good sander (and a capable person using it) will take all colour away. When re colouring the door always use a Seperate stain and varnish and give at least 5 to 6 coats of varnish using glasspaper before final coat and the result will be perfect
